Transaction 109033a51a5e51060071b355d22bea7e2b44b3fbd1b39094c3b283a91271f7e8
2 Input
2 Outputs
- 109033a51a5e51060071b355d22bea7e2b44b3fbd1b39094c3b283a91271f7e8:0
- 109033a51a5e51060071b355d22bea7e2b44b3fbd1b39094c3b283a91271f7e8:1
value 34685
address 1PH8KuHVZdVn5LFWPAkhPAa374HujR2UkA
value 2428251
address 13SSuQTD3KpdKhFkeg1NbXYV8D3ubLmjX9